How to Say ‘The style look like?’ in German

Der Stil aus?

dair shteel ows

[dair shteel ows]

💬 Usage Tip: This completes the separable verb: aussehen. Together: Wie sieht der Stil aus? = What does the style look like?

🇩🇪 In Germany: Stil is an important word in German creative work—design, film, photography, and branding all use it constantly.

Phrase Breakdown

Der

[dair]

the

Masculine definite article here, used with Stil.

Example

Der Stil aus dem Moodboard ist modern.

The style from the mood board is modern.

Stil

[shteel]

style

The visual or creative character of a project, film, or campaign.

Example

Der Stil aus dem Pitch wirkt sehr klar.

The style from the pitch seems very clear.

aus

[ows]

out

Separable prefix of aussehen; in questions it appears at the end.

Example

Der Stil sieht modern aus.

The style looks modern.
